Description

Grey Goose L'Orange Vodka 750ML is a French orange-flavored vodka bottled at 40% ABV (80 proof) in a 750ml bottle, infused with the natural essence of fresh oranges. What distinguishes this expression is its source material — over two pounds of oranges per liter, drawn from Florida, Brazil, and the Mediterranean — and a proprietary vacuum distillation process for the orange oils that preserves delicate citrus character.

Quick Facts: ABV: 40%  |  Origin: Cognac, France  |  Flavored Vodka (Orange)  |  Distillery: Grey Goose (Bacardi Limited)

Production & Heritage

Grey Goose was founded in 1997 by Sidney Frank and is now owned by Bacardi Limited. The base spirit is distilled from soft winter wheat grown in the Picardie region of northern France, combined with natural spring water from Gensac Springs in the Cognac region, and run through a five-step distillation process. For L'Orange, the orange extraction is remarkably involved: whole oranges are first lightly compressed for juice, then more firmly crushed to release essential oils from the peel. The fruit is sprayed with cold water and the liquid is allowed to separate, with oil siphoned off the surface using a tapping method. A specially designed column still then vacuum-distills the filtered oils twice at pressures up to 1,000 times lower than atmospheric pressure, dropping the boiling point to roughly 60°C to avoid heat damage. Only about 20% of the resulting orange oil fractions are selected and blended into the final spirit — a level of selectivity uncommon in the flavored vodka category.

Tasting Notes

Aroma: The nose opens with pungent, ripe orange peel and fresh mandarin zest. Behind the citrus burst, faint floral scents emerge alongside a light, clean grain undertone.

Taste: The palate is clean and elegant on entry, with zesty satsuma orange taking the lead at mid-palate. A subtle sweetness develops alongside a peppery, grainy vodka note that keeps the profile from veering into candy territory. The orange reads as natural fruit rather than synthetic flavoring.

Finish: The finish is medium in length, driven by bitter orange peel and a flicker of cracked black pepper. It closes dry and crisp, leaving a clean citrus impression without lingering sweetness.

How to Drink Grey Goose L'Orange

Neat or slightly chilled, L'Orange lets its citrus extraction work speak for itself — a small ice cube opens the aromatics without diluting the orange intensity. It is equally at home in cocktails where orange is a structural flavor rather than a garnish afterthought.

  • Cosmopolitan: L'Orange replaces both the base vodka and the need for additional orange liqueur, streamlining the build while adding natural citrus depth.
  • Vodka Sunrise: The orange essence reinforces the fresh orange juice, creating a more cohesive citrus backbone against the grenadine.
  • Orange Martini: Shaken with a dash of dry vermouth and an expressed orange twist, L'Orange delivers a cleaner, more aromatic take on the classic vodka martini.

Frequently Asked Questions

What does Grey Goose L'Orange taste like? It tastes like fresh, zesty orange peel with a clean grain backbone, a touch of peppery spice, and a dry, bitter-orange finish — closer to biting into an actual orange than to orange candy.

How does Grey Goose L'Orange compare to Ketel One Oranje? Both are premium orange-flavored vodkas at 40% ABV, but L'Orange uses a vacuum distillation process for its orange essence and sources oranges from three growing regions, while Ketel One Oranje is enhanced with two varieties of oranges and tends to present a slightly sweeter, softer citrus profile. L'Orange generally leans more toward bitter orange peel and zest, whereas Oranje reads a bit juicier and rounder.

Is Grey Goose L'Orange good for cocktails? It is one of the more versatile orange vodkas for cocktail use because its natural, non-cloying orange flavor integrates cleanly without adding unwanted sweetness to balanced recipes.

Where is Grey Goose L'Orange made? Grey Goose L'Orange is produced in the Cognac region of France, where the base wheat spirit is distilled and blended with Gensac Springs water. The orange essence is prepared separately using oranges sourced from Florida, Brazil, and the Mediterranean.

What foods pair well with Grey Goose L'Orange? Dark chocolate truffles complement the bitter orange peel character. Seared duck breast with an orange glaze echoes the citrus notes naturally. Fresh ceviche works well, as the vodka's acidity and citrus mirror the lime in the dish. Light goat cheese salads with citrus vinaigrette create a clean, harmonious pairing. Orange-scented crème brûlée reinforces the dessert-side versatility of the spirit.

What sizes does Grey Goose L'Orange come in? Grey Goose L'Orange is widely available in the standard 750ml bottle, with 1L and 1.75L formats also commonly found in the market, as well as 50ml miniatures and 375ml half-bottles in select areas.

Why Grey Goose L'Orange?

The defining differentiator here is the extraction and distillation process. Where most flavored vodkas rely on simple infusion or added flavor compounds, Grey Goose vacuum-distills its orange oils at extremely low pressure to preserve volatile aromatic compounds that would be destroyed by conventional heat. Only 20% of the distilled oil fractions make the final cut, which explains the spirit's clean, non-synthetic orange character. The multi-origin sourcing — Florida, Brazil, and Mediterranean oranges — adds complexity that single-source expressions typically lack. For drinkers who have written off flavored vodka as artificially sweet, L'Orange is a legitimate reason to reconsider the category.
